Re: File, Edit etc menu options in panel
A common name for such is a global menu. From time to time there have been applets or plugins to make a global menu but at least for Cinnamon (Global AppMenu) and for MATE (TopMenu) these look to be dead. I don't readily know of alternatives but provide some specifics first.
If you want help with such you should at minimum include your Linux Mint version and desktop environment. Any solution is going to be specific to the desktop environment you're using and some solutions may be available for older/newer versions so be specific when asking for help. Re: Global menu in Cinnamon?
I don't think you'll be able to get this working. Global AppMenu for Cinnamon was a 3rd party applet but the developer stopped supporting it. You can find old articles online about people trying to get the (half a decade ago) abandoned code to work on newer Cinnamon releases. If you search for "Cinnamon global menu" you'll find such like https://z-uo.medium.com/global-menu-in- ... fea74370fe. I wouldn't recommend it considering it's abandoned but if you must you and don't care you may be wasting time you could give it a try.
Before you do so I suggest to create a 2nd administrator account so if that you break it bad enough that you can't log in to your account you can log in to the 2nd account and from there delete the offending files from your own account.
